Atty. Kristine Pauline M. Ongtenco shared insights on the Fundamentals of Mooting at an event organized by LAMDES

Our Atty. Kristine Pauline M. Ongtenco was invited by the DLSU Tañada Diokno College of Law’s Moot and Debate Society (LAMDES) to share her insights on the fundamentals of mooting. Atty. Ongtenco shared her experiences in mooting and talked about how these helped in her professional practice at GSMH Law. She specifically discussed the importance of narrative in legal writing and how mooting can develop legal analysis and storytelling skills, preparing mooters for the real thing.

Atty. Ongtenco was an accomplished mooter who competed in several moot court competitions, both locally and internationally.  She was an Oralist and Key Researcher at the Asia-Pacific Rounds (2018, 2019) and at the Global Rounds, Miami Florida (2019) of the Foreign Direct Investments Arbitration Moot.  She was also the Team Captain and Oralist (2019) at the Philippine rounds of the Jessup Moot Court Competition.

Atty. Ongtenco currently handles high stakes commercial litigation and investments at GSMH Law.

The event was hosted by LAMDES and held at the College of Law – De La Salle University Rufino Campus at the Bonifacio Global City on September 9, 2023.
